Recognizing Common Red Flags in Text Message Scams
Recognizing Common Red Flags in Text Message Scams is an essential step in protecting yourself from becoming a victim. Spam text messages often contain urgent or threatening language, asking for personal information or immediate action. A legitimate employer will never demand sensitive data via text and will typically provide detailed instructions for applying to a job through official channels. Be wary of messages that request payment upfront or threaten legal action without a clear and credible source.
Additionally, look out for spelling mistakes, generic greetings, and unfamiliar phone numbers. Scammers often use automated systems to send mass texts, leading to inconsistent messaging. If you receive a job offer via text that seems too good to be true, verify the authenticity through a trusted source, such as contacting the company directly using official contact information found on their website or consulting with a Spam Text Attorney in North Dakota for guidance.
Legal Actions and Protections for Spam Text Victims in North Dakota
In North Dakota, victims of spam text job offer scams have legal protections and options available to them. If you’ve received unsolicited texts promoting employment opportunities or asking for personal information under deceptive pretenses, it’s considered a form of spam and telemarketing fraud. A Spam Text Attorney in North Dakota can help individuals navigate these complex issues. They can assist with sending cease and desist letters to the culprits, blocking future communications, and even pursuing legal action if necessary.
Under North Dakota law, businesses must obtain explicit consent before sending text messages for marketing purposes. This includes job recruitment texts.
